How large is Stony Brook University?
Stony Brook University—SUNY is a public institution that was founded in 1957. It has a total undergraduate enrollment of 18,010 (fall 2020), its setting is suburban, and the campus size is 1,454 acres.
How many semesters are there in Stony Brook University?
two semesters
In addition to these two semesters, classes are offered during a January Winter Session term and two Summer Session terms. Visit the Registrar’s Office Web site for a detailed academic calendar.

Does Stony Brook require SAT 2022?
Stony Brook will be test optional for applicants for Spring 2022, Fall 2022, and Spring 2023. Consideration is given to students who have performed well in advanced science and math courses, as well as those who have participated in science, math, and research competitions.
